I'm a big Hypershift guy, and in general a big macro/shortcuts user. My day to day life has been so much simpler when I got a razer keyboard, but there is one thing that is bugging me. I have started running short on keyboard, and it's beginning to become a bit frustrating.
My proposal is that modifier keys could be used to make an unbelievable amount of extra shortcuts.
Let me explain, FN + S + G = open stem, FN + S + M = open spotify, FN + V + arrow up = volume up and FN + M + 1 = macro1.
If this is doable it would really open up a world of possibilities, with a lot more macro options, and yeah, i know i could just buy a new razer keyboard, and set up the keys on that be macros, but i am a poor student that dont really have enough money/space for that.
